Learning Communities
Beginning in 2010, T.H. Chan School of Medicine students became members of Learning Communities, established to allow more inter-class interaction where students can learn from each other as they will when they are out in the real world. All entering first-year students are assigned to one of six “Houses,” each with regionally significant names. Each House includes approximately 125 students, four cohorts from all four class years. These social and academic homes are overseen by faculty mentors, who act as advisers, teachers and career development coaches. The Class of 2024 has been placed in Houses as represented below.
